Apple Patent Application Describes Touchscreen Keyboards You Can Feel

Imagine a world where your touchscreen keyboard actually feels like physical keys. Sounds futuristic, right? Well, Apple might just be making this sci-fi dream a reality. A recent patent application from Apple describes the concept of touch-sensitive, dynamically configurable keyboards that provide tactile feedback to users.

If you've ever typed on a touchscreen device, you know that one of the biggest drawbacks is the lack of physical buttons. While virtual keyboards have come a long way in terms of accuracy and responsiveness, many users still miss the satisfying click-clack of physical keys.

Enter Apple's innovative idea. The patent application outlines a system where a touchscreen keyboard could simulate the feeling of physical buttons by using advanced haptic feedback technology. Haptic feedback, often used in modern smartphones for vibrations and tactile responses, could take typing on a touchscreen to a whole new level.

How does this technology work? Well, the patent suggests that Apple's system could incorporate a combination of sensors and actuators to provide users with the sensation of pressing physical keys. By detecting the pressure and movement of your fingers on the screen, the keyboard could generate realistic feedback that simulates the tactile experience of traditional keyboards.

One of the key advantages of this technology is its flexibility. The patent describes how the layout of the virtual keys could be dynamically adjusted based on the user's typing habits or the specific application being used. This means that the keyboard could adapt to different languages, input methods, or even switch between a traditional layout and specialized controls for tasks like video editing or gaming.

For those concerned about the potential drawbacks of a touchscreen keyboard that tries to mimic physical keys, the patent also addresses the issue of inadvertent key presses. The system could intelligently differentiate between intentional keystrokes and accidental touches, ensuring a smooth and reliable typing experience.

While it's important to note that a patent application doesn't guarantee that a technology will be implemented in a product, Apple's track record of pushing the boundaries of user experience gives hope that we might see this innovative keyboard concept in future devices.
